ALOha!
Here is a nice audience recording from TaperBruce (you rock!).
http://www.archive.org/details/alo2007-12-31.rodent4.morris.flac16
A bit chatty, but that can be expected for a NYE gig. Zach even says that they left more space between songs than usual to accommodate the social nature of a New Year's Eve party. MC Wavy Gravy adds some authentic San Francisco flavor to the proceedings--compounded by a surprise sit-in by Grateful Dead drummer Bill Kreutzmann on They Love Each Other > Use Me > They Love Each Other. A cover of Peter Gabriel's "Sledgehammer" busts open the new year in a big way, a rare Celery Stalker adds some crunchy grooves, and the 3-day long BBQ sandwich closer seals the deal to top off another epic NYE run. What a fantastic year it's been for ALO, with the resounding success of Roses & Clover, tons of XM-radio airplay, gigs all over the world, and a burgeoning legion of fans--the future looks bright for the Animal Liberation Orchestra!
